Grandma Spider Brings the Fire is a beautifully illustrated retelling of a traditional Southeast Indian tale, presented bilingually in Chickasaw and English. Suitable for early readers aged 5 to 8, this story emphasizes themes of bravery and the power of small acts. The book offers a culturally rich experience while teaching valuable lessons about courage and community.
